What Is the Cost of Living Near Flint?

Understanding the cost of living near Flint is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at CS Mott Community College.
Flint's Cost of Living Index is approximately 74.8 (25.2% less expensive than US average; 18.1% less than MI average). Facing economic challenges, extremely affordable housing. MTA bus. When planning your budget based on a salary from CS Mott Community College,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$600 - $900+ A significant portion of CS Mott Community College sal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$160 - $260 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$40 (MTA mon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$350 - $520 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$250 - $500+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$330 - $620+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$1,730 - $2,800+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
